Partey wins Footballer of The Year Award at maiden Ghana Football Awards

Black Stars midfielder Thomas Partey has been named the Footballer of the Year at the maiden edition of the Ghana Football Awards in Accra.
Partey was also named the Foreign-based Footballer of the Year for the awards which recognised the exploits of Ghanaian footballers in the period under review (the 2017-2018 season) on Sunday night.
Partey, 25, made 52 appearances and scored five goals for Atletico as they bounced back from a UEFA Champions League group stage exit to win the UEFA Europa League.
Thomas (as Partey is known at Atletico) distinguished himself predominantly as a right fullback and in midfield for Diego Simeone’s side as they also finished second behind Barcelona in Spanish La Liga and exited the Cope del Rey at the quarter-final stage.
For the senior national team – the Black Stars – Partey tied down a spot as a regular in the team with some scintillating displays from midfield, netting his first career hat-trick in a 5-1 win over Congo in a 2018 World Cup qualifier in September 5, 2017.
He also captained the Black Stars in recent friendlies against Japan and Iceland in the absence of skipper Asamoah Gyan.
The first awardee of the night was Aduana Stars and Black Stars B goalie Joseph Addo who was named the Goalkeeper of the Year, who was recognized for his role in Ghana’s 2017 WAFU Zone B Cup triumph and league title success with Aduana in the Ghana Premier League. He edged goalies Razak Abalora and Richard Ofori to the award.
Addo’s club Aduana also emerged the Team of the Year and 20-year-old Majeed Ashimeru of Red Bull Salzburg pipped Princella Adubea (Dampen Darkoa Ladies) and David Abagna (Wa All Sars) to the Future Star of the Year award reserved for players aged 20 years or below.
Star forward for Ampem Darkoa Ladies, the serial National Women’s League – Princella Adubea was named the Women’s Footballer of the Year while a superb strike by Joseph Mensah emerged Goal of the Year.
Below  is the complete list of award winners;
1. Goalkeeper of the Year
Richard Ofori (Maritzburg United & Black Stars)
Razak Abalora (WAFA)
Joseph Addo (Aduana Stars & Black Stars B) – WINNER
2. Team of the Year
WAFA
Aduana Stars – WINNER
Ampem Darkoa ladies
3. Future Star Award
Majeed Ashimeru (WAFA & Black Stars B) – WINNER
David Abagna Sandan (Wa All Stars)
Princella Adubea (Black Princesses & Ampem Darkoa Ladies)
4. Foreign-based Player of the Year
Jordan Ayew (Swansea)
Albert Adomah (Aston Villa)
Thomas Partey (Atletico Madrid) – WINNER
5. Goal of the Year – Joseph Mensah
6. Women’s Footballer of the Year – Princella Adubea- WINNER
7. Living Legend Award – Anthony Baffoe – WINNER
8. Home-Based Player of the Year
Thomas Abbey (Hearts of Oak) – WINNER
Stephen Sarfo (Berekum Chelsea)
Daniel Darkwah (Aduana Stars)
9. Coach of the Year
Yussif Abubakar (Aduana Stars) – WINNER
Klaus Rasmussen (WAFA)
Mercy Tagoe (Black Queens Coach)
10. Thumbs Up Award – Asamoah Gyan (WINNER)
11. Ghana Footballer of the Year
Jordan Ayew (Swansea)
Albert Adomah (Aston Villa)
Thomas Partey (Atletico Madrid) – WINNER
Thomas Abbey (Ismaily)
Richard Ofori (Maritzburg United)
